1. Understanding the Basics: How Time Zones Work
Time zones are like invisible lines drawn across the Earth, each representing a 15-degree slice of longitude. When the sun hits noon in one time zone, it’s still morning in the next one over. This system was introduced in the late 19th century to standardize timekeeping, making it easier for trains to run on schedule and for everyone to know when to eat their lunch. 3. Tips for Managing Time Zone Differences
Living in a world where time zones vary so drastically can be challenging, especially for frequent travelers and remote workers. Here are some hacks to keep your sanity intact:
- Use a World Clock App: Apps like World Time Buddy can help you stay on top of time zone differences without needing a calculator. 📱⏰
- Schedule Meetings Wisely: Always consider the other person’s time zone when scheduling calls or meetings. A quick email check-in can save you both from awkward early morning or late-night calls. 📧⏰
- Adjust Your Sleep Schedule: If you’re traveling across multiple time zones, start adjusting your sleep schedule a few days before your trip to ease into the new time zone. 🛌⏰
